Thomson owner to axe 2,600 UK jobs
Last Modified: 15 Dec 2006
Source: ITN
Around 2,600 UK jobs are being axed by the owner of Thomson Holidays as part of a Europe-wide restructuring programme.
German travel group Tui is cutting a total of 3,600 posts in its tourism division, but said the UK will be affected more as market changes have been far more dramatic in the UK compared with central Europe.
Tui, which owns former Lunn Poly travel agent shops, said the job losses are part of a cost-cutting programme aimed at saving 250 million (£168m) in the tourism division by 2008.
